## Sensor drift: what to do at 3am

If the GrowLoop controller starts reporting humidity swings that don't match the backup probes in the Fernwick greenhouse, it's almost always sensor drift, not an actual climate event. Don't panic and don't touch the vents manually. First, restart the calibration daemon and give it ten minutes to re-baseline. If readings still disagree by more than 5%, flip the controller into safe mode. The safe-mode thresholds it will use are these.

config for yahap-bajof:
[istix]
host = istix.qorvelsys.internal
user = istix_svc
database = istix_prod

**Mgmt Meeting Minutes — Retiring the Brightline Range**

Quick recap for sales leads at Fenholt Supplies: we agreed to retire the Brightline fixture range by year-end. Remaining stock moves to clearance pricing next month, and accounts on standing orders get migrated to the Lumetta range. Trade-in incentives were approved in principle. The confidential note on next steps sits just below.

board note of bajof-bajeg: The pricing group signed off on a budget of $13.4 million for Project Sildor. The renewal with Lamixek Holdings closes at $48.9 million a year, 49 percent above the last contract.

Hi Maren,

Handing off the Feedwright validator pager. The RSS schema checker threw false positives overnight on enclosure lengths; I muted rule E-14 until the fix ships Thursday. Everything else is green. Watch the Castlight queue after the 02:00 crawl. If anything odd shows up, the feeds platform team can be reached below.

escalation mailbox, fafof-bahip: tamael@ordincorp.test

## Onboarding: Thumbnail Generation Queue

The Frameloft thumbnail queue consumes upload events and renders previews through the internal Pixelgrist service. Workers must authenticate on startup; unauthenticated workers will poll indefinitely without claiming jobs, which looks like a silent stall. Future maintainers should note that the credential is scoped to render-only operations and cannot delete source assets. The Pixelgrist key the workers load at boot is recorded below.

app token of kajop-tahag = qvz23-qaEp6MzrfP2AwhVbZwsZeUq